PCD End Mills

All the advantages of the diamond blade—without compromising results.
The extreme hardness of the diamond coating, combined with the toughness of carbide offers the best in effective, cost-efficient milling:

  • Low forces and reduced coefficient of friction
  • Lower machine tool power consumption
  • Increased stability for longer tool life

Optimum Contour Accuracy
Intricate grooves, transition radii or chamfers– almost any contour – can be produced by the PCD blade without distortion. Several features on one tool.


- Optimum contour accuracy
- No distortion on intricate grooves, transition radii or chamfers.

- Availble with multiple tooling features

Optimum Geometry
Spirally arranged chip space geometry and the division of cut on the blade allow very high rates of stock removal when rough milling.


- Spirally arranged chip space geometry

- Cut blade division
- High rate of stock removal when rough milling
